When choosing the best concealed carry positions, the ability to access your firearm quickly and safely should be a primary consideration. The position you select influences how you draw your weapon, affecting not only speed but also the technique required to do so effectively. Developing consistent training routines and building muscle memory for drawing from your chosen carry spot dramatically improves reaction time while minimizing the chances of fumbling or unsafe handling. Practicing regularly in realistic scenarios enhances your confidence and ensures that accessibility and draw speed align with your daily needs and comfort level. When choosing a concealed carry position, paying attention to the different types such as appendix, strong side, small of the back, and other variations helps in finding the most suitable fit. Each position offers unique advantages and disadvantages; for example, appendix carry provides quick access and concealment but may be less comfortable for some during sitting or bending. Strong side carry is comfortable and familiar for many but might be slower to draw in certain situations. Small of the back carry can be easy to conceal yet might be problematic when sitting or for long periods due to discomfort and the potential risk of injury. Considering where you will mostly be wearing the firearm, the type of clothing, and your daily activities contributes to selecting a position that balances accessibility, comfort, and concealment effectively. Trying different positions and adjusting holsters can help determine what feels best and meets personal needs, especially when thinking about situational readiness and ease of movement throughout the day. Choosing the appropriate method for carrying a concealed weapon often depends on how well the safety and retention features match the specific position you prefer. Different best concealed carry positions offer unique retention mechanisms that help keep the firearm firmly in place, which is especially helpful when moving through crowded or active environments. Preventing accidental discharge during the draw is another important aspect; holsters designed for certain carry positions typically cover the trigger guard completely and require deliberate action to release, reducing the chance of unintended firing. Ensuring weapon security in active environments means considering how well the holster retains the firearm during physical activity and how easily you can access it without compromising safety. Selecting a holster with retention features that correspond to the chosen carry spot helps maintain control and peace of mind throughout daily activities. When selecting the best concealed carry positions, comfort and daily wearability play a significant role in ensuring longterm comfort for extended wear throughout the day. Positions that distribute the weight evenly can help prevent strain on the back and hips, which positively impacts posture and movement, making it easier to carry without noticeable discomfort. Holster types designed with padding or flexible materials often enhance comfort by molding to the body’s contours, allowing for natural motion without restriction. For example, inside-the-waistband holsters generally offer better concealment while maintaining comfort for many users, whereas appendix or small-of-back carry might require holsters with added support to minimize pressure points. Considering both the location of the carry position and the holster design encourages ease of movement and helps maintain a discreet appearance without sacrificing comfort during everyday activities. Prioritizing positions and gear that accommodate sitting, bending, or walking ensures sustained comfort during various use cases, which is essential for those who wear concealed carry regularly. Choosing the best concealed carry positions often depends on body type and clothing choices, as these elements influence both comfort and effective concealment. People with different body shapes may find certain positions more comfortable and less noticeable; for example, those with a slimmer frame might prefer appendix carry because it sits well along the front of the body, while individuals with a larger midsection may benefit from strong-side or small-of-the-back carry to reduce printing. Clothing style plays a role as well, since looser shirts or jackets can help conceal grips and outlines more effectively, whereas fitted clothing requires careful consideration of carry location to avoid visible bulges. Seasonal clothing variations also impact concealment options—during warmer months, carrying in positions that allow for quick access while maintaining low visibility despite lighter garments becomes important, while colder seasons offer more layering, which can obscure the firearm more easily but may require adjustments to avoid bulkiness that interferes with movement. Balancing these factors helps in choosing a carry spot that synergizes with one’s physique and wardrobe, ensuring both practicality and discretion. Choosing the right concealed carry position involves understanding how your firearm’s size corresponds with the carrying style that feels most comfortable and discreet. Smaller firearms tend to work well in positions that offer closer body contact, making them easier to conceal and carry throughout the day. Holster selection plays a significant role as well; different styles and materials not only affect comfort but also influence accessibility and retention. Options such as leather, Kydex, or hybrid holsters offer varying levels of flexibility and durability, so exploring these can help in finding one that suits both your daily activities and personal preferences. Additionally, having adjustability features or customization capabilities in a holster can greatly improve your overall experience by allowing you to fine-tune the fit, cant angle, and ride height, which enhances concealment without sacrificing quick access. Thoughtfully matching these factors with your lifestyle ensures that your concealed carry setup remains practical, secure, and comfortable for regular use. Appendix carry offers quick access and easier concealment, especially for smaller firearms, making it popular for everyday carry. It can be more comfortable for some users when sitting, as the gun rests at the front of the body. However, appendix carry carries a higher risk of injury during a negligent discharge due to its proximity to vital areas, and it may be uncomfortable for those with larger bodies or those who frequently bend at the waist.
Strong side carry, typically positioned on the hip, is considered safer since the firearm points away from the body, reducing injury risk. It is also more comfortable for many when standing or walking and allows for easier access when drawing from a seated position in vehicles. On the downside, it can be more challenging to conceal, especially with smaller guns, and may be less accessible in tight spaces. Ultimately, choice depends on personal comfort, safety preferences, and daily activities.
